IPTV vs. Cable: Which is Right for You?
Deciding between standard cable and Internet Protocol Television can be a difficult choice. Cable delivers channels via coaxial wires , while IPTV utilizes the internet to deliver programs to your screen. Consider aspects such as cost , program lineup, picture quality , and convenience . IPTV often offers increased flexibility with on-demand options , but relies on a reliable internet link . Cable generally features a consistent connection , but can be less flexible and pricier.

Setting Up Your Beginning IPTV System: A Easy Manual
So, you're ready to cut the cord traditional television and explore the realm of IPTV? Beginning can seem a little daunting, but it's surprisingly straightforward. First, you'll need a working device – this could be an Android box, a smart TV, a computer, or even a smartphone. After that, you should obtain an IPTV provider; investigating options and comparing their offerings is crucial. After you have a provider, you’ll be given copyright details , usually a username and password. Finally, you'll provide these details into your chosen IPTV application and you’re ready to go to enjoy a huge selection of content . here Remember to always check your internet bandwidth for optimal streaming quality.
Troubleshooting Common IPTV Problems
Experiencing issues with your internet protocol television setup? Don't worry ! Many common difficulties can be readily addressed with a little effort . First, ensure your internet link is stable – a unreliable signal is a main cause of interruptions. Next, test restarting your device ; this basic process often resolves minor glitches . If the problem continues , examine your router and network configurations . Finally, reach out to your streaming provider for assistance ; they can determine more significant network problems .

Top IPTV Services and Devices for Streaming
Finding the perfect way to bypass traditional TV involves selecting the right IPTV application and supporting gadget . Several excellent options are available, catering to various needs. Here's a snapshot at some of the leading choices. For Android phone owners, applications like TiviMate and Perfect Player are widely regarded as feature-rich choices, offering a intuitive interface and extensive customization features . If you prefer iOS, you’ll likely need to utilize a third-party IPTV application through a web browser . Hardware-wise, media players such as the NVIDIA Shield TV or Xiaomi Mi Box S are superb choices due to their processing power and support for a broad selection of platforms. Alternatively, a simple Android stick can provide a budget-friendly solution. Finally, remember to always check the legality of your chosen IPTV provider to prevent any possible issues.
